Malvern villa lays on the charm

Regardless of the challenges facing society, at least one constant remains when it comes to the Adelaide property market – the popularity of character homes.

A bluestone villa recently listed by Toop&Toop Real Estate in the prime suburb of Malvern is evidence of that.

The charming 1910 home sits on a block of more than 670m2 on tree-canopied Winchester Street, which runs directly off Unley Road and is one of the most exclusive stretches in the prestigious suburb.

Despite restrictions on open inspections and auctions because of the coronavirus, the property has garnered strong buyer interest since its launch in mid-April.

The four-bedroom, two-bathroom property attracted hundreds of virtual inspections in the first week of its campaign, with a number of parties subsequently arranging one-on-one private viewings.

Toop&Toop Director of Residential Sales, Bronte Manuel, said the home’s classic features – such as its bluestone façade, high ceilings, polished floorboards and original fireplaces – were common draw cards for astute South Australian buyers.

The property’s easy access to the Adelaide CBD and proximity to quality schools adds to its desirability.

“Buyers recognise the great potential of this style of property,” Manuel said.

“This is already a beautiful, very liveable home in a wonderful location … but there’s scope to enhance the character features and perhaps add a high-end extension at some stage.

“By doing so, you would end up with an extremely valuable home.”

While the impact of the coronavirus had changed the dynamics of the local real estate market, Manuel said buyers were adapting well.

“Before the coronavirus restrictions, we may have seen 100 people at an open inspection,” he said.

“Of those, we might have ended up with a handful who were keen to pursue the property and potentially make an offer.

“Now we might have, say, 10 private one-on-one viewings for the same property – and still end up with multiple offers.

“So of the people we are showing through a home, there’s a high proportion of quality buyers.”
